### 1. `convert.py` — Photo → JPG Thumbnails

Supports RAW, JPG, and HEIC/HEIF input. By default, thumbnails are output to `{input}/thumbnails/`.

```bash
# Convert all photo files (thumbnails output to ~/data/RAW/thumbnails/)
python3 scripts/convert.py ~/data/RAW

# Custom settings
python3 scripts/convert.py ~/data/RAW ~/data/output/thumbnails --size 2048 --quality 95

# Read file list from stdin (pipe from find_by_date.py)
python3 scripts/find_by_date.py --date today ~/data/RAW | \
    python3 scripts/convert.py --from-stdin

# With report output
python3 scripts/convert.py ~/data/RAW --report /tmp/convert_report.json

# Dry run
python3 scripts/convert.py ~/data/RAW --dry-run
```

| Option         | Description                        | Default               |
| -------------- | ---------------------------------- | --------------------- |
| `input`        | Photo file or directory            | from config           |
| `output_dir`   | Output directory                   | `{input}/thumbnails/` |
| `--size`       | Max thumbnail dimension (px)       | 1200                  |
| `--quality`    | JPEG quality (1-100)               | 85                    |
| `--workers`    | Parallel workers                   | auto (max 8)          |
| `--recursive`  | Search subdirectories              | off                   |
| `--overwrite`  | Overwrite existing files           | off                   |
| `--dry-run`    | Preview only                       | off                   |
| `--no-exif`    | Skip EXIF copy                     | off                   |
| `--report`     | Output processing report JSON path | none                  |
| `--from-stdin` | Read file paths from stdin (JSON)  | off                   |

### 2. `find_by_date.py` — Find Photo Files by Date / Detect Timelapse

Searches for RAW, JPG, and HEIC/HEIF files by EXIF shooting date. Outputs JSON path list to stdout. Also detects timelapse sequences by identifying runs of photos with regular shooting intervals.

```bash
# Find by exact date (outputs JSON to stdout)
python3 scripts/find_by_date.py --date 3月15日
python3 scripts/find_by_date.py --date 2026-03-15

# Date range
python3 scripts/find_by_date.py --from 2026-03-10 --to 2026-03-15

# Save output to file
python3 scripts/find_by_date.py --date 3月15日 --output ~/data/found_files.json

# List all dates
python3 scripts/find_by_date.py --list-dates

# Timelapse: detect sequences with regular intervals, exclude casual shots
python3 scripts/find_by_date.py ~/data/RAW --timelapse
python3 scripts/find_by_date.py ~/data/RAW --timelapse --output ~/data/timelapse_found.json
python3 scripts/find_by_date.py ~/data/RAW --timelapse --min-sequence 50

# Pipe to convert.py
python3 scripts/find_by_date.py --date today ~/data/RAW | \
    python3 scripts/convert.py --from-stdin
```

| Option                 | Description                                    | Default |
| ---------------------- | ---------------------------------------------- | ------- |
| `--output`, `-o`       | Save JSON output to file                       | stdout  |
| `--timelapse`          | Detect timelapse sequences (regular intervals) | off     |
| `--min-sequence`       | Minimum frames to qualify as timelapse         | 30      |
| `--interval-tolerance` | Interval deviation tolerance (0.5 = ±50%)      | 0.5     |

Supported date formats: `2026-03-15`, `03-15`, `3月15日`, `today`, `yesterday`, `3 days ago`
